This isn't something that shows up on the LIVE site. This is something that shows up at the bottom of the website when logged into as an admin. It is a shortcut to edit the website. This is something that has been around a long time with wordpress sites where you could navigate to a page and then click "edit" and you would go directly to that page in the admin area to make changes to it. It was a very simple thing to turn off in wordpress sites but I cannot figure out how to turn that off on Shopify.

This is not something possible to remove within the Shopify. Additionally, it's not something that your customers can see either.
It's possible to create your own custom CSS/Javascript using a Chrome Extension like this and hide the bar via custom code, but this would not be related to Shopify.
